thermal radiation
Physics term for electromagnetic radiation emitted by a body due to its temperature. Used in scientific and technical contexts.
Thermal radiation becomes stronger as the temperature of an object increases.
The Earth emits thermal radiation into space.
対流 is convection (heat transfer through fluid movement), distinct from radiative transfer.
Compound of 熱 (heat) and 放射 (radiation). A straightforward technical term with no obscure historical derivation.
